Carl S. Pederson is a scholar working on Food Science, Nutrition and Dietetics and Cell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Carl S. Pederson has authored 33 papers receiving a total of 513 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Food Science, 8 papers in Nutrition and Dietetics and 3 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Carl S. Pederson’s work include Food Quality and Safety Studies (12 papers), Fermentation and Sensory Analysis (6 papers) and Microbial Metabolites in Food Biotechnology (6 papers). Carl S. Pederson is often cited by papers focused on Food Quality and Safety Studies (12 papers), Fermentation and Sensory Analysis (6 papers) and Microbial Metabolites in Food Biotechnology (6 papers). Carl S. Pederson collaborates with scholars based in United States, Philippines and United Kingdom. Carl S. Pederson's co-authors include L. R. Mattick, Mette Christensen, Marie L. Vorbeck, Andrew Rice and Frank A. Lee and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Analytical Chemistry and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ry.
